Charity & Partnerships Events Lead

1 week ago


Liverpool, United Kingdom Fletchers Solicitors Full time

**Salary**:Up to £35k (depending on experience)

**Location**:North West/Hybrid with regular travel to our network of offices

Fletchers Group has an exciting opportunity for a dynamic and results-driven Events and Marketing Manager to join our corporate communications team to support our extensive and growing charity and partnerships events programme.

At Fletchers, we are proud to work with a wide range of charity partners who share our ambition to help rebuild the lives of people who have suffered serious life changing injuries and for them to have the very best possible life after injury.

We support and host a huge range of charity events every year that our clients, colleagues and other stakeholders can all get involved with, and we are now looking to grow our team to help us support even more amazing events and projects.

You will be valued for your organisational skills and your ability to set expectations clearly and effectively with a range of internal and external stakeholders. You will provide synergy and manage relationships between our charity and partnership team and our legal teams to successfully deliver impactful events and support the valuable work of our charity and partners.

**Your key responsibilities**
- Plan, organise, and execute our charity and partnership events programme, including identifying event goals, working with cross-functional and external teams, managing budgets, and reporting.
- Manage the event marketing budget to stay within plan, ensure cost-effective use of resources, and maximising ROI.
- Coordinate event logistics including travel, venue selection, catering, equipment, and accommodation.
- Analyse the effectiveness events and make recommendations based on these findings.
- Develop and build engaging event content including presentations, promotional materials, and follow-up communications that positively represent our brand and strengthen our market leadership.
- Order and track event inventory including collateral, giveaways, etc.
- Coordinate with external vendors and partners to ensure high-quality event execution.
- Negotiate contracts and manage vendor relationships.
- Work closely with the charity and partnerships team and wider legal teams, to ensure events support overall business goals and objectives.
- Stay up to date with the latest event marketing trends, technologies, and strategies.

**What we need from you**
- Proven experience in managing successful events preferably in the legal and/or third sector.
- Minimum of 5 years experience in a similar role
- Experience of working in a fast-moving environment, with an ability to manage numerous projects simultaneously and within deadlines.
- A self-starter with excellent time management and prioritisation skills.
- Strong communication skills for effective interaction with both internal and external stakeholders.
- Excellent written and verbal communication, with a sharp eye for detail and the ability to proof and approve finalised content.
- Ability to write concise briefs for digital and design teams, photographers, and production companies.
- Willingness to travel to support events.

**About Fletchers Group**

Fletchers is a growing law firm specialising in personal injury and clinical negligence law, with excellent rankings with both the Legal 500 and Chambers & Partners. Following several acquisitions, we have transformed into the Fletchers Group, with ambitious plans for further expansion. Situated in the North-West of the UK, our offices are located in Manchester, Liverpool, Southport, Leeds, Bolton, and Cambridge. Many of our colleagues enjoy the flexibility of hybrid work arrangements. We offer a great work-life balance, attractive benefits, apprenticeship or training contract opportunities, and avenues for internal progression. Currently, approximately 10% of our colleagues participate in apprenticeships or training contracts, marking a milestone for us as we continue to improve our Learning & Development programs. Our culture is nurturing, designed to assist you in achieving your aspirations. Additionally, we have our Associate and Partner programs for senior lawyers and established the Fletchers Foundation to support those who have suffered injuries.
